The Eastman Nature Center Trails

Located within Elm Creek, the Eastman Nature Center offers several well-maintained trails ideal for hiking. These trails wind through diverse habitats, including forests, prairies, and wetlands. Hikers can enjoy spotting various wildlife and plant species along the way.

Bass Ponds Trail

The Bass Ponds Trail is a scenic route that circles several ponds, providing beautiful views and opportunities for birdwatching. This trail is relatively flat, making it a great option for families and those seeking a leisurely hike.

Prairie Trail

For a taste of the open landscape, the Prairie Trail offers a unique hiking experience. This trail cuts through expansive prairie land, showcasing native grasses and wildflowers. It’s an excellent choice for experiencing the natural beauty of Elm Creek.

Singletrack Trails

For mountain bikers, Elm Creek features several singletrack trails that wind through the woods. These trails offer a more challenging ride with varied terrain, including hills, turns, and technical sections.

Beginner Biking Trails

New to biking? Elm Creek has beginner-friendly trails that are relatively flat and smooth. These trails are perfect for learning and building confidence on a bike.

FAQ About Trails of Elm Creek

What are the best trails for beginners?

For beginners, the Bass Ponds Trail and the paved paths in the regional trail system are excellent options. These trails are relatively flat and easy to navigate.

Are there any challenging trails for experienced hikers and bikers?

Yes, the singletrack trails and the more rugged sections of the Eastman Nature Center trails offer a challenge for experienced hikers and bikers.

Can I bring my dog on the trails?
